Maak advertensie toe

Toe Apple verlede jaar "Project Catalyst" met groot fanfare by WWDC bekend gestel het, het dit ontwikkelaars gewin met 'n wonderlike toekoms van verenigde toepassings vir al sy platforms, sowel as een universele App Store vir almal. Met die koms van macOS Catalina het die projek 'n soort eerste implementeringsfase betree, en selfs nou, twee dae na die aanbieding, is dit duidelik dat die oorspronklike visie nog ver van vervul is.

Eerstens is dit nodig om te herinner dat die belangrikste mylpaal in verband met die Catalyst-projek die jaar 2021 is, wanneer alles gereed moet wees, die toepassings moet universeel wees oor platforms, wat deur een App Store verbind moet word. Die huidige toestand is dus die begin van 'n relatief lang reis, maar reeds, volgens die ontwikkelaars, is verskeie ernstige probleme besig om na vore te kom.

Eerstens is die hele proses om toepassings van iPad na Mac oor te dra nie so maklik soos wat Apple verlede jaar aangebied het nie. Alhoewel Catalyst 'n gebruikerskoppelvlak insluit wat met behulp van eenvoudige opsies die toepassing outomaties van die iOS (of iPadOS) omgewing na macOS verander, is die resultaat beslis nie perfek nie, inteendeel. Aangesien sommige ontwikkelaars hulle laat hoor, is die bestaande nutsgoed in staat om die fundamentele funksies van die toepassing vir die behoeftes van macOS oor te dra, maar die resultaat is dikwels baie broos, beide vanuit die oogpunt van ontwerp en vanuit die oogpunt van beheer.

'n Voorbeeld van 'n outomatiese toepassingpoort deur Catalyst (hieronder) en 'n handgewysigde toepassing vir macOS-behoeftes (hierbo):

appel katalisator macos toepassing

Dit maak die "maklike en vinnige" proses nie baie doeltreffend nie, en ontwikkelaars moet steeds ure van hul tyd belê om die oorgedrade toepassing te wysig. In sommige gevalle is dit glad nie die moeite werd nie en dit sal beter wees om die hele toepassing te herskryf. Dit is beslis nie 'n ideale situasie uit die ontwikkelaars se oogpunt nie.

'n Groot probleem is ook dat, soos dit tans opgestel is, inprogram-aankope nie oorgedra word nie. Dit kan baie maklik gebeur dat gebruikers wat die iPadOS-weergawe van die toepassing gekoop het, weer daarvoor op macOS moet betaal. Dit maak nie veel sin nie en ondermyn die hele inisiatief 'n bietjie. Catalyst het ook lou ontvangs van sommige ontwikkelaars ontvang. Een van die hooftitels (Asphalt 9) is uiteindelik nie betyds vrygestel nie en word na die "einde van die jaar" geskuif, ander het heeltemal verdwyn. Daar is ook nie veel belangstelling in Catalyst van ontwikkelaars nie – Netflix beplan byvoorbeeld nie om hierdie inisiatief te gebruik nie.

Die ontwikkelaars stem saam dat dit 'n goeie stap vorentoe en 'n wonderlike visie is. Die vlak van uitvoering is egter op die oomblik ernstig tekort, en as Apple nie die situasie begin aanspreek nie, kan sy grootse plan uiteindelik 'n klug wees. Wat 'n groot skande sou wees.

macOS Catalina-projek Mac Catalyst FB

bron: Bloomberg

.